Air travel options for residents of the Mumbai Metropolitan Region are set to widen significantly as IndiGo prepares to roll out a fresh set of direct connections from Navi Mumbai Airport starting 29 March. The expansion will link the airport with six destinations — Ahmedabad, Goa, Rajkot, Belagavi, Kolhapur and Diu — strengthening regional connectivity and offering passengers more convenient alternatives to existing routes.

The move was confirmed in an official announcement by the airport authorities, highlighting a strategic push to connect Tier-2 and Tier-3 cities with the Mumbai region. These flights will be operated using ATR aircraft, typically deployed on short-haul regional sectors. With the summer schedule coming into effect at the end of March, several additional services are also expected to be introduced, increasing daily flight frequency and improving overall travel flexibility.

Connectivity between Gujarat and the Mumbai region is expected to receive a notable boost through this development. The Ahmedabad service will operate daily, departing Ahmedabad at 7:10 PM and arriving in Navi Mumbai at 8:40 PM. The return leg will leave Navi Mumbai at 9:10 PM and reach Ahmedabad at 10:35 PM, making it a convenient same-evening travel option for business and leisure passengers.

Morning travelers will benefit from the Rajkot route, which will depart Navi Mumbai at 7:00 AM and land in Rajkot at 8:15 AM. The return service will take off at 8:45 AM and arrive back in Navi Mumbai at 9:45 AM. This early schedule is expected to cater especially to business travelers seeking quick turnaround trips.

Flights to Diu will also operate daily. The departure from Navi Mumbai is scheduled at 10:05 AM, with arrival in Diu at 11:15 AM. The return journey will commence at 11:40 AM, ensuring same-day connectivity between the two destinations.

While detailed timings for Belagavi and Kolhapur services are yet to be released, officials have confirmed that these schedules will be announced shortly. Their inclusion further underlines the focus on enhancing regional air links and making smaller cities more accessible from the financial capital’s extended airport network.

Notably, Navi Mumbai Airport has been functioning round-the-clock since 1 February, allowing 24-hour flight operations. This operational flexibility is expected to support the addition of more routes and higher flight frequencies in the coming months.

Commercial passenger services at the airport originally began on 25 December 2025. Since its inauguration, the airport has witnessed a strong response from travelers across Mumbai, Navi Mumbai and Thane. Plans are also underway to introduce cargo services soon, which will further strengthen the airport’s role as a growing aviation hub.
